New RegCL framework adapts SAM for multi-sensorial AI

Researchers have developed RegCL, a novel framework for continually adapting the Segment Anything Model (SAM) for visual grounding in multi-sensorial media like AR/VR and embodied AI. Unlike traditional methods that require extensive replay data or domain-specific modules, RegCL employs a non-replay approach that merges lightweight adaptation modules, such as LoRA-style AugModules, into a single, compact adapter. This method optimizes prediction consistency and retains historical feature statistics, demonstrating superior performance across diverse segmentation datasets compared to existing continual learning and merging baselines. RegCL's compact nature makes it suitable for evolving media pipelines. AI
